The Traveling Philosophizing Travel Writer-Philosopher Human

Location

To live!

To feel!

Rejoice in every sound and sight of each and every forgotten and forsaken place!

To travel, lift my skinny fists to the sky, and write about it!

To capture my evasive thoughts and feelings and experiences, how transient they are, and declare them to the world!

To face each and every gathering storm and each and every rising sun! to not live vicariously, but to live! To live, man, live!

How done I am with the cyclical nature subscribed to me! how done I am with the common desk and trivialities!

To write from mountains, Mizen head, and monsoons! from exotic bays, Barcelona, and hot air balloons!

To wake and meet the phenomena of man! Not the American man, but man! You, man, you! The world and all we have reaped!

Let me laugh over Indian seas! Let me be lonely in Borneo! Let me go and let me breathe- give me space, give me space, give me space! Oh, to shake hands with the human race!

The pen - a broom! To dust away the lines between a job and a life and suddenly - one comes from two!

To make the most of this life, to find meaning in its pain and its pleasures, to embrace the world in its extravagance and its complexity - and to write about it, oh, to write about it...

See, man, see! I am a human, and humans sometimes live and always die. Some go on to buy houses, televisions, and cars! Some will make much money and some will not - but see, man, see! That is not the life for me! All we are born with is all we have got!

So see, man, see! Function has replaced meaning, but the world is here and the world is now and one day either you or it will be gone. So to see it and record it- man, what a job!

See, man, see! I am a human, and humans sometimes live and always die! Some will empty themselves out and some will work, work, work without realizing finality, not money, gives meaning to life! But man, oh man, to be a travel writer! Oh, what a job and what a life! To make sure when my time is here, there are words left to live and a human left to die!
